St. Paul, Minnesota: Birthplace of F. Scott Fitzgerald

Famous author of the Jazz Age, drank himself to death at 44, is buried outside Washington, DC. His first name was Francis.

Address:
481 Laurel Ave., St. Paul, MN
Directions:
A mile west of downtown. On the north side of Laurel Ave. between Arundel and N. Mackubin Sts (closer to Mackubin). You'll see two multi-storied, columned buildings. The plaque is on the left building, bolted to the column to the left of the front door.
Admission:
Free

Birthplace of F. Scott Fitzgerald

A plaque at 481 Laurel Avenue notes that author F. Scott Fitzgerald was born on the second story and lived in the house until the age of two. The house is privately owned, but if the owner is outside watering his plants he might invite you in. Just half a mile away at 599 Summit Avenue is where Fitzgerald wrote his first novel, "This Side of Paradise."
